<p>Functionalised crown ethers, process for their preparation and their application as complexing agents for ions, especially cations. The functionalised crown ethers according to the invention correspond to the general formula (I): <IMAGE> in which: n = 3, 4 or 5, m = 1, 2, 3 or 4 and the groups F, which are identical or different, are chosen from: <IMAGE> in which: R1, R2 and R3 are chosen from H, aryl, cyano and halo and the groups R, -SOR and SO2R where R denotes a C1-10 alkyl, C1-10 alkenyl or C1-10 alkynyl group, the said groups being linear or branched and being optionally capable of being substituted by one or more radicals chosen from hydroxyl, alkoxy, aryloxy, alkoxycarbonyl, carbonyl, halo, aryl or nitrile radicals or an organometallic group of formula -M(X)3 in which M = Si or Sn and the symbols X, which are identical or different, are chosen from C1-5 alkyl, C1-5 alkenyl, C1-5 alkynyl or aryl radicals; R', R'', R''' and R'''', which are identical or different, are chosen from H, C1-5 alkyl, C1-5 alkenyl, C1-5 alkynyl or aryl, it being additionally possible for the radicals R' and R'' on the one hand and R''' and R'''' on the other hand to form together a carbonyl group; Y is chosen from Si, Sn, O, SO, SO2, -NA-, with A chosen from H, C1-5 alkyl, C1-5 alkenyl, C1-5 alkynyl or aryl; Z denotes a direct bond, Si, Sn or else a -(C=O)- or -O-(C=O)- group, q = 0 or 1 0 </= p + q + r + (number of atoms in the main chain of Z) </= 4.</p> |
